Comprehending the Roomba Self-Emptying System
The roomba self Empty self-emptying system was developed to streamline the cleaning process. With standard vacuum, the user must frequently empty the dustbin, which is typically unpleasant and can result in allergens being launched into the air. A self-emptying Roomba handles this process instantly, holding particles in a base station up until it is ready to be disposed of.
How It Works
Upon completion of a cleaning cycle, the Roomba autonomously returns to its base station. Here, it employs a powerful suction mechanism to transfer gathered dirt and debris from its onboard dustbin into a larger, sealed bag located within the base. The system likewise features a filter to trap irritants and fine dust, making your home more sanitary.

The self-emptying feature provides a multitude of advantages to users, improving benefit and efficiency:
Reduced Maintenance: With the self-emptying function, users no longer need to fret about regularly emptying the dustbin. This indicates less inconvenience and more time saved.
Improved Hygiene: The sealed dust bag avoids dust and allergens from escaping back into the air during disposal. The anti-allergen technology helps filter out fine particles, promoting cleaner indoor air quality.
Longer Cleaning Cycles: With a bigger debris capability in the base station, the Roomba can operate for prolonged durations, cleaning larger areas without disruption.
Uncomplicated Operation: Users can set up cleaning sessions without requiring to physically intervene for emptying the dustbin. The Roomba manages everything autonomously.
Optimal Performance: The self-emptying function enables the Roomba to preserve peak efficiency over longer periods, as it does not end up being bogged down by a full dustbin.

Regularly Asked Questions (FAQ)1. How often does the Roomba self-empty?
The Roomba self-empties based upon individual use patterns and space sizes. Usually, it clears into the base station after each cleaning, depending upon how much particles it has gathered.
2. Just how much maintenance does a self-emptying Roomba need?
Very little upkeep is needed. Users must frequently replace the dust bag in the base station and tidy the Roomba's brushes and filters as specified in the user manual.
3. Are Roomba self-emptying systems loud?
A lot of Roomba models are designed to operate quietly. The self-emptying mechanism can produce some sound; nevertheless, it is normally comparable to a traditional vacuum cleaner.
4. Can I control my Roomba through an app?
Yes! The majority of Roomba designs include a mobile app that permits users to monitor cleaning schedules, control the gadget from another location, and customize settings.
5. What is the series of the Roomba self-emptying robot?
The range will depend on the design. Usually, the cleaning coverage can vary from 1,000 to 2,000 square feet on a single charge.
